内の2つのテーブルを制御するためにどのように私は同じNIBで2 UITableViewsを必要としています。私はIBを使用し、2つのテーブルを持つビューを作成しました。iPhoneは:1 NIB
マイヘッダファイルのViewControllerと二つのクラス、テーブルのそれぞれに1つずつ(下記参照)を含みます。 IBでは、各テーブルのデリゲートとデータソースをFileOwnerに接続することができますが、IBOutlet接続を作成する方法を考えることはできません。 - [News tableView:numberOfRowsInSection:]:インスタンスに送信された認識できないセレクタ0x15d3c0 2011-12-11 07:20:27.480 myCity1 [659:707]キャッチされていない例外「NSInvalidArgumentException」のためにアプリケーションを終了しています。 、理由: ' - [ニュースのtableView:numberOfRowsInSection:]:認識されていないセレクタはインスタンス0x15d3c0に送られた'
はここでヘッダファイルです:
@interface News : UIViewController {
}
@end
@interface TownNews : UITableViewController {
UITableView *townNewsTable;
}
@property (nonatomic, retain) IBOutlet UITableView *townNewsTable;
@end
@interface GeneralNews : UITableViewController {
UITableView *generalNewsTable;
}
@property (nonatomic, retain) IBOutlet UITableView *generalNewsTable;
@end
おかげMakaronをチェックDidSelectRowAtIndexPath
NumberOfRowsInSection、NumberOfSection、CellForRowAtIndexPath、同様にすべてのテーブルビューの代表者にタグの助けを借りて比較。それははるかに簡単に見えます。感謝 – Jeremy